Transaction 2bb58498803e7626c7afdfc9fbde14071cef04a1e4054233437fa3d290556f31

1 Input
2 Outputs
  • 2bb58498803e7626c7afdfc9fbde14071cef04a1e4054233437fa3d290556f31:0
  • value  6884565
    address  3HvXMSs3SvSWcatr7Tb2b5jp5np8ppYiTH
  • 2bb58498803e7626c7afdfc9fbde14071cef04a1e4054233437fa3d290556f31:1
  • value  8810125
    address  18hAVUXz2C9Dumxo8p588nFSvZwKJs1FKF